Frequently Asked Questions about Hancock

What type of rentals are currently available in Hancock?

There are currently 66 Apartments for Rent in Hancock, MN with pricing that ranges from $600 to $2,819. There are also 38 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Hancock ranging from $400 to $4,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Hancock?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Hancock ranges from $400 to $4,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,778.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Hancock?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Hancock range from $1,150 to $1,995,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$975 to $2,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,850.
